Tobramycin: A Potent Aminoglycoside Antibiotic

Tobramycin is an aminoglycoside antibiotic derived from the bacterium Streptomyces tenebrarius. It is primarily used to treat serious Gram-negative infections, including Pseudomonas aeruginosa, especially in patients with cystic fibrosis. Tobramycin is administered in multiple formulations-injectable, inhalation, and ophthalmic-and is valued for its potency and effectiveness in cases resistant to other antibiotics.

Due to its broad application in hospital settings, Tobramycin remains a staple in the global antibiotic arsenal. Its demand continues to grow in both developed markets and emerging economies, driven by increasing infection rates, antimicrobial resistance, and demand for hospital-grade antimicrobials.

Manufacturing Process Overview

Fermentation and Downstream Processing

Tobramycin is produced via a microbial fermentation process using Streptomyces tenebrarius. The key steps include:

Seed Culture Development

Preparation of the starter culture under sterile, optimized conditions.

Fermentation

Submerged fermentation in stainless steel bioreactors under controlled temperature, pH, and aeration.

Broth Clarification and Extraction

Separation of the fermentation broth, followed by solvent extraction to recover the crude antibiotic.

Purification and Concentration

Multi-step purification using chromatography, precipitation, and crystallization techniques to isolate and purify Tobramycin.

Drying and Packaging

Lyophilization or spray drying of the purified product to obtain the API in powder form.

Equipment and Technology Requirements

Manufacturing Tobramycin at a commercial scale requires the following major equipment:

Fermenters and seed tanks
Centrifuges and filtration units
Solvent recovery and extraction systems
Chromatography columns and associated resins
Drying units (spray dryer or lyophilizer)
Cleanroom packaging equipment

Infrastructure and Utility Needs

Setting up a Tobramycin production facility involves:

Dedicated cleanroom areas (GMP-compliant)
Controlled air handling systems (HVAC)
Water for injection (WFI) and RO systems
Steam and compressed air lines
Waste treatment for solvent and biological residues
